Admission sessions take place throughout the year. Candidates who are interested in the Master in Marketing and Creativity can only apply once per academic year and are required to complete the steps below.
We have tried to make our application process as easy as possible. To begin yours, please click here.
Please complete each section of the application form in full. You should also supply the contact details of two referees, who will then receive an online recommendation questionnaire. Important: recommendations must be provided in the format requested. Please choose two reliable referees and ensure they will be available to complete the online form before entering their details in the corresponding section of your application. Please note that you will not be able to change your nominated referees after submitting the application.
At the end of the application you will be asked to pay a fee of £130 via Paypal or with your debit/credit card. Once the transaction is complete, your application will be submitted. Your file will be reviewed and we will be in touch to inform you of the result and next steps.
Please note that you can upload the required supporting documents listed below during the online process. If you are invited for an interview, you will be asked to bring the original documents with you.

Applications are not reviewed at the beginning of each new admission period. Please wait until after the deadline has passed before contacting our Admissions Department with questions regarding your application's status.
Non-EU students are advised to apply before the final application deadline in order to allow plenty of time for visa issues to be resolved. Please note that students are responsible for their own visas; any accepted non-EU candidate unable to secure their study visa will not have their application fee refunded.

Admission decisions are sent out by email and post within two weeks of your interview having taken place. Applicants who are offered a place must confirm their acceptance in writing by the deadline indicated in the offer letter. A non-refundable deposit of 10% (deductible for the payment) of the full tuition fee is required to secure a place in the programme once admission has been granted.
Candidates unable to attend interviews on-campus because of distance, current employment outside of Europe, etc., can opt for a webcam interview instead. In such cases, applicants will also have to take the admission test via webcam. Please note that only exceptional circumstances will be accepted as a valid reason to not attend the interview and admission test in person.
